Today, I decided it made sense to do something with the ferrite core and windings. I had soldered it before but now I realise I ought to have done a bit more than that as it's tended to loosen and unwind. Not good. So, the really dodgy bits I rewound more neatly. The use of language at this point I leave to the imagination but my eyesight is awful so it led to some frustration. I then tried sealing with some wax. I've never done this before. Most of the radios I worked on to date never had ferrite rods but just used a large wire. Anyway, I simply lit a candle, melted some wax and sealed the windings. It now looks a fair bit neater although I am not too happy with the circuit as a whole since the delicate threads show some wear. After I finished I tested with the meter and that read O.K. It was the best I could do really.
I only just noticed the other day the barrel waveband selector has lots of simple access hatches to the oscillator windings. Simply undo the screw and you can remove the panel and check with a meter. I have that job later.
I located one red square capacitor Miguel recommended to remove as they are unreliable.
The P and MP Type transistors have all been checked around the legs very carefully. I did notice the RF transistors may really whistle like a dentist's drill when you touch the case.
